Public Safety Telecommunicators Salary in Vermont
SOC 43-5031 · Vermont · BLS OEWS May 2024
The median salary for Public Safety Telecommunicators in Vermont is $55,328 per year ($26.60/hr). This is 9.1% higher than the national median of $50,731. The middle 50% earn between $51,272 and $62,754 annually. Top earners at the 90th percentile reach $69,243.
Wage Percentiles: Vermont
| Percentile | Hourly Rate | Annual Salary | vs National |
|---|---|---|---|
| P10 | $22.15 | $46,072 | +29.3% |
| P25 | $24.65 | $51,272 | +21.7% |
| P50MEDIAN | $26.60 | $55,328 | +9.1% |
| P75 | $30.17 | $62,754 | -0.1% |
| P90 | $33.29 | $69,243 | -11.3% |
